文摘Objective To investigate the effects of TGF- β1 on proliferation and type N collagen mRNAexpression of rat renal interstitial libroblasts in vitro for elucidating the role of fibroblasts in renal interstitialfibrosis. Methods The cells were cultured in media containing various concentrations of TGF- β1. Theproliferation and the type Ⅲ collagen mRNA expression of the cells were assayed with MTT method andRT- PCR respectively. Results TGF- β1, has a stimulating proliferation effect with dose- dependence and aincreasing expression of type Ⅲ collagen mRNA with both dose- and time- dependence to the renal fibroblasts. Conclusion It is suggested that TGF- β, is involved in proliferation of renal fibroblasts and their type Ⅲcollagen mRNA expression, and may play an important role in renal interstitial fibrosis.

文摘Objective To investigate the effects of transforming growth factor-β1 (TGF-β1 ) on the expression of plasminogen activator inhibitor type 1 (PAI-1 ) mRNA in renal interstitial fibrosis in vitro. Methods Human renal interstitial fibroblasts were isolated and cultured in vitro. The cells wers stimulated by TGF-β1 with different concentration (0 to 10ng/ml ) at different time (0 to 48h). The expression of PAI-1 mRNA was assayed by RT-PCR. Results TGF-β1, had dose-dependent and time-dependent effects on the expression of PAI-1 mRNA in renal interstitial fibroblasts. Conclusion TGF-β1 may partic- ipate in renal fibrosis with inducing the expression of PAI-1 mRNA in renal fibroblasts and affecting the synthesis and degradation of extracellular matrix (ECM).
